2025 Fantasy Outlook
With Marc-Andre Fleury's retirement after the 2024-25 season, Wallstedt has his best chance to make the NHL roster out of the gate in 2025-26. However, he won't have much momentum on his side after an AHL season in which he went 9-14-4 with a 3.59 GAA and a .879 save percentage. The 22-year-old also allowed eight goals over two NHL appearances last season. Wallstedt is the Wild's goalie of the future, but he won't be handed the crease on a silver platter. He'll have to compete with Filip Gustavsson for every start, and it's possible the Wild add a veteran on a two-way deal to provide competition for Wallstedt. In redraft formats, fantasy managers can wait and see how the workload gets divided in Minnesota's crease. Read Past Outlooks

Falls to Avs in shootout
GMinnesota Wild
March 9, 2026
Wallstedt stopped 34 of 36 shots in regulation and overtime and two of four shootout attempts in Sunday's 3-2 loss to Colorado.
ANALYSIS
The young netminder came up with a number of big stops, but he couldn't deny Nathan MacKinnon in the fourth round of the shootout. Wallstedt has begun to find his form again while working as Filip Gustavsson's backup, allowing three goals or fewer in three of his last four starts dating back to Jan. 27. However, since the calendar flipped to 2026, Wallstedt has gone 3-4-2 in 10 outings with a 3.92 GAA and an .882 save percentage.

2024 Fantasy Outlook
Wallstedt is one of the top goaltending prospects in pro hockey, and his time could be fast approaching. His consistency has sometimes been criticized as robotic, and he doesn't have Yaroslav Askarov's acrobatic athleticism, but fantasy managers will take strong and steady any day of the week. While Minnesota's Filip Gustavsson struggled in the NHL, Wallstedt had a terrific season behind a weak Iowa squad in the AHL. His .910 save percentage was top 20 overall for a team that finished among the league's worst. It would be a huge step for Wallstedt to start in the NHL, but he could end up splitting time with Marc-Andre Fleury if Gustavsson gets traded. Minnesota's goaltending situation will be worth monitoring in 2024-25.

Expected to start Sunday
GMinnesota Wild
October 11, 2024
Wallstedt is expected to defend the visiting crease in Winnipeg on Sunday, according to Jessi Pierce of NHL.com.
ANALYSIS
Wallstedt is part of a three-goaltender rotation in Minnesota this season, along with Filip Gustavsson and Marc-Andre Fleury. Gustavsson got the call Opening Night on Thursday, while Fleury is expected to play at home Saturday against the Kraken. That leaves Sunday's tilt in Winnipeg for Wallstedt to make his season debut. Wallstedt is considered the Wild's goaltender of the future and playing with the veteran Fleury all season can only help his career.
